While Marvel may own the big screen, DC is containing their ever expanding universe on television and today, we have a look at the brand new CW crossover series, DC's Legends of Tomorrow. Legends will follow a team of side characters seen in both series Arrow and The Flash, as the team together to travel through time and defeat and evil, immortal enemy, known as Vandal Savage. The trailer shows off the handful of familiar faces from various seasons of Arrow and from the first season of The Flash that's nearing it's finale. A lot of big TV announcements have been made over the last few days and one of the biggest ones was a first look at CBS new series, Supergirl, set to debut this fall. Supergirl, follows the story of Superman's cousin, Kara Zor-El, as she discovers to embrace the abilities she spent a long time hiding. The trailer shows us a lot from her daily life to some possible love interest and sets up, what might be, a very interesting story. The latest Mortal Kombat character to get his own statue is on it's way and it looks pretty amazing. The War God, Kotal Kahn, is pictured above in his three variations from the game title and all look equally as brutal. His Blood God and War God forms featuring him holding weapons,while the Sun God is just shown posing with a bloody heart in hand as are the other statues. The pre-order will be available May 18th at 3pm but these figures are extremely limited as the Blood God statue will only ship 250 units, the Sun God will ship 500 and the War God will ship 350. Looks like we got some more news about Nintendo's up coming gaming console due out for next year and it doesn't look good. President Satoru Iwata stated that the game would not be present at this years E3 presentation, which is not too surprising considering the original plan was for a full reveal sometime in 2016. The next console from Nintendo was announced alongside a partnership with gaming mobile company, DeNA, with goals to publish their popular franchises on mobile systems in the near future. It looks like we'll be waiting a bit longer to find out what the new "NX," is all about but until then, hopefully E3 will be used as an opportunity to explain the fate of the Wii U and just what titles we will and won't see release for it this year.
After a very rocky first season, it looks like there's some good news for Peggy Carter as ABC announced that Marvel's Agent Carter will be renewed for a second season! This is also announced along side that Marvel's other ABC series, Marvel: Agent's of S.H.I.E.L.D. has also been renewed for it's third season! The announcement came from Variety alongside other popular series like Fresh Off the Boat, Blackish, Scandal, how to get Away With Murder, and Modern Family. The Universe continues to expand. Sherlock and The Hobbit trilogy star, Martin Freeman, was confirmed today by Marvel for a role in the upcoming film, Captain America: Civil War. The actor, with an impressive number of awards under his belt, joins his Sherlock co-start in the third phase of the Marvel Cinematic Universe. The biggest question at the moment is just who Martin Freeman will play? Will he play a supporting role to the Avengers or possibly have a role to play with the newest avengers, Spider-man, who's also being added to the mix. After the amazing Joker reveal, director David Ayer treated fans to a tweet when he let loose this image featuring the full case of the upcoming DC villain film, Suicide Squad. As you can see, some members of the cast look far different from their comic book versions like Enchantress and even Harley Quinn, but this set photo has definitely made fans excited about what's to come. Starting from the left, we have Adam Beach as Slip Knot, Jai Courtney as Boomerang, Karen Fukuhara as Katana, Cara Delevingne as Enchantress, Joel Kinnaman as Rick Flag, Margot Robbie as Harley Quinn, Will Smith as Dead Shot, Adawale Akinnuoye-Agbaje as Killer Croc and Jay Hernandez as El Diablo. Ayer later tweeted out a closer up image of Deadshot following the cast photo. What's even more interesting was the leak of these photos of Batman actor, Ben Affleck, on set of the Suicide Squad. From an upcoming issue of Vanity Fair, Game of Thrones actress Gwendoline Christie, who plays Brienne of Tarth, is shown here in her chrome stormtrooper costume. After the announcement was made last June, fans speculated as to just who she would play in the star wars universe and today we finally have our answer. Christie will star as Captain Phasma, one of the officers of The First Order. This isn't the only big news we received today as we also found out that actress Lupita Nyong'o has been reveled as the pirate, Maz Kanata and Adam Driver will star as the masked sith jedi, Kylo Ren. No one was more confused than the fans were when it was announced that the comic book character, Quicksilver, would appear in Joss Whedon's Avengers: Age of Ultron (this of course being confirmed in Captain America: The Winter Soldiers post credits), just short of a year after the same character appeared in Bryan Singer's X Men: Days of Future past and one question has been on all our minds, just which is the better version? 1. The Costumes To be frank, neither of the two received positive reactions when the pictures first surfaced. Much more notably, Evan Peter's (pictured on the right) reveal via Empire Magazine received a landslide of backlash from fans but, after the films release, the change made sense. Between the two, Bryan Singer fit the times but Joss Whedon gets the point for having the closer, of the two, to the original costume. 2. The Jokes Avengers: Age of Ultron is funny, a lot funnier than expected and a good handful of those moments are delivered from Quicksilvers character. A bit loose and sarcastic, his simple "didn't see that coming," became an on going joke throughout the film. Quicksilver in Days of Future Past however, is down right hilarious. With what felt like 5 minutes of screen time (but I'm sure it's closer to twenty,) his interactions with Wolverine and Professor Xavier are some of the best parts of the film and the comment he makes about his father is hilarious to any comic fan. This one goes to Peters. 3. The Plot Lastly, and most important, is analyzing the role they played, which is a bit complex. The two characters are vastly different, existing in different universes and interacting with different teams. The Quicksilver in X Men:DoFP, is a young kid in the 70's, living at home with his sister and mother and is a known trouble maker. The Age of Ultron version is a war torn orphan who, along with his twin sister, aids Ultron in his plot to make the world a better place before realizing just what's at stake. One of the biggest differences here is the fact that Scarlett Witch does not officially appear in X Men: Days of Future Past, nor is she the same age as her brother. He also plays a much smaller role as opposed to the Maximoff twins, who played an on-going role throughout the second Avengers film. There's also an obvious difference in speech patters, one being from America while the other was from Eastern Europe. Unfortunately, Evan got the short end of the stick in Days of Future Past, but was such a hit with the audience that his character is reportedly being brought back for the sequel, X Men: Apocalypse, in 2016. For now, Quicksilver's role dominates in the lengthy Avengers sequel takes this one. Bonus: Special Effects While Age of Ultron featured some amazing action sequences, Days of Future past will hold the title of having one of the absolute best slow-motion sequences in film history.
